Are you living on autopilot?

A friend of mine always says first, with a smile on his face, “I am grateful to be alive.”

When I was in my late 20s, I went to the hospital to have a growth removed that the doctor thought might be cancerous. My Mom came to the hospital with me. Once I was on the operating table, the anesthesiologist gave me anesthesia to put me under. When the procedure was over and I was in the recovery area, the doctor and surgical staff could not wake me up and the doctor asked my Momma to come in.

Momma said to him in a clear loud excited voice “Wake her up!”

I came to with the doctor pounding on my chest and my Momma standing nearby!

I was having a happy dream and did not realize they were unable to wake me up! If not for my Momma I would have been dead!

The doctor said, “You are allergic to the anesthesia I gave you and I was not able to wake you up until your Mother insisted I wake you up.”

“Do not ever allow them to give you this type of anesthesia again!”

They discovered that I was allergic to one of the drugs that I was given during surgery.

I nearly didn’t wake up; but I was oblivious… because I was unconscious.

Do you know someone who listens to the news without stopping, 24 hours a day? If that is their only intake of information, they are likely quite bitter and angry.

What can you do to improve this situation?

Replace an hour of listening/watching/reading the news with something uplifting, growth oriented, or gratitude related. See how you feel after one week. How about after one month?

Are you still angry? Has your mood improved? Are you able to think clearly and focused?
